As a member of BNI then I would say that I find it very hard to give
referrals to those people who I don't think provide a value for money
service.
We have one or two in our chapter and I would not give them a referral or
testimonial - unless it was someone who had annoyed me.
There are on the other hand some very, very good people in the chapter too -
our motor repairs man and the electrician come immediately to mind.
Hopefully what will happen is that those who aren't very good get starved of
referrals and then drop out.
With web design - I think the problem is that different web companies have
different specialities and very few people outside the field know the
difference between a good web site and a crap one.
Even talking to the different designers on this forum you will get
differences of opinion. I personally think that unless a client is warned
that his flash site is no more than brochureware and will not bring him new
customers and has specifically requested the site be produced in flash - the
site is crap. From my point of view a website has to perform in generating
new customers and lead to be good.
Here is one of my best sites http://www.boxermotorworks.co.uk - fairly plain
nothing really going for it in design terms. I am sure that some people
would say that the site is crap.
Once you have finished criticising the design - do a search on google.com
for 'Mercedes servicing' - then do the same on MSN.co.uk - the site
generates a couple of new customers each month for the client, who is very
happy with his website.

Hi Mart
I agree with all of your points, apart from the final one. One of the
points that we're trying to make is that the image of the BNI is being
tarnished within the web design field because it is allowing in people who
produce very shoddy work. To quote from Hutch's email:
"And if the other people in that chapter were as shit at their jobs as the
web design bloke then I honestly don't think I was
missing out on anything more than a lot of grief"
While there might be business to be made in cleaning up the mess left behind
by them, the fact that they've been recommended by a BNI member casts all
subsequent referals by that member/chapter/BNI in a bad light. Each chapter
is supposed to implement some form of quality control, but this is obviously
not working for web designers, and it's something that has to be addressed.
Hence our desire to see some contact amongst web designers who are members
of the BNI so that these sort of issues can be addressed.
